What companies run services between Baumholder, Germany and Merzig, Germany?

You can take a train from Baumholder, Bahnhof to Merzig via Idar-Oberstein, Bahnhof and Saarbrücken Hbf in around 3h 8m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Baumholder, Unterer Markt to Neues Rathaus, Merzig via ZOB, Freisen, ZOB, St.Wendel, and Busbahnhof, Wadern in around 4h 26m.
